Database Design for Mere Mortals Book Summary - Database Design for Mere Mortals Book explained in key points

Database Design for Mere Mortals summary

Michael J. Hernandez

Brief summary

Database Design for Mere Mortals is a practical guide that demystifies the process of designing a database. It covers fundamental concepts and provides step-by-step instructions, making it accessible to beginners and valuable to experienced professionals.

Give Feedback
Table of Contents

    Database Design for Mere Mortals
    Summary of key ideas

    Understanding the Fundamentals of Database Design

    In Database Design for Mere Mortals by Michael J. Hernandez, we embark on a journey to demystify the often intimidating world of database design. Initially, Hernandez introduces us to the fundamental concepts of databases and their role in managing data. He carefully explains the importance of a well-structured database, which not only stores data but also ensures its accuracy, integrity, and security.

    Hernandez then delves into the heart of database design, beginning with the process of identifying and organizing data elements into appropriate tables. He emphasizes the significance of understanding the relationships between these tables and choosing the right data types and field sizes to ensure efficient data storage and retrieval.

    Creating Effective Database Structures

    As we progress, Database Design for Mere Mortals takes us through the process of creating a comprehensive database structure. Hernandez emphasizes the importance of normalization, a technique that helps eliminate data redundancy and inconsistencies, ensuring data integrity. He provides practical guidance on how to normalize a database, from first normal form through to fifth normal form.

    Furthermore, the book discusses the concept of keys, including primary, foreign, and alternate keys, and their critical role in maintaining data integrity and establishing relationships between tables. Hernandez also introduces us to the process of creating indexes, which enhance the performance of database queries.

    Implementing Data Integrity and Business Rules

    In the subsequent sections, Database Design for Mere Mortals focuses on implementing data integrity and business rules within the database. Hernandez explains how to enforce data integrity using referential integrity constraints and how to define and enforce business rules using triggers and stored procedures.

    He also highlights the significance of documenting the database design, emphasizing that a well-documented database is essential for its efficient management and maintenance. The book offers practical advice on creating documentation, including data dictionaries and entity-relationship diagrams, to ensure that the database's design and functionality are well-understood.

    Practical Application of Database Design Principles

    As we near the end of our journey, Database Design for Mere Mortals shifts its focus to the practical application of the principles learned. Hernandez discusses the process of implementing the database design using a database management system (DBMS), emphasizing the importance of testing and refining the design to ensure its effectiveness.

    He also provides insights into the process of database redesign, highlighting that database design is an iterative process that may require adjustments based on changing business requirements. The book concludes by discussing the role of the database designer and the importance of ongoing maintenance and monitoring of the database.

    Conclusion: A Foundational Understanding of Database Design

    In conclusion, Database Design for Mere Mortals equips us with a foundational understanding of database design, emphasizing the importance of a well-structured, normalized, and documented database. Hernandez's accessible writing style and real-world examples make complex concepts understandable, ensuring that even those new to database design can grasp the essential principles.

    By the end of the book, readers gain the confidence to embark on their own database design projects, armed with the knowledge of best practices and practical techniques. Whether you're a novice or experienced database designer, Database Design for Mere Mortals serves as an invaluable guide to creating effective and efficient database structures.

    Give Feedback
    How do we create content on this page?
    More knowledge in less time
    Read or listen
    Read or listen
    Get the key ideas from nonfiction bestsellers in minutes, not hours.
    Find your next read
    Find your next read
    Get book lists curated by experts and personalized recommendations.
    Shortcasts
    Shortcasts New
    We’ve teamed up with podcast creators to bring you key insights from podcasts.

    What is Database Design for Mere Mortals about?

    Database Design for Mere Mortals by Michael J. Hernandez is a comprehensive guide that demystifies the process of designing a database. Written in a clear and engaging style, this book is perfect for beginners and experienced professionals alike. It covers everything from the basics of database design to advanced topics, making it an essential resource for anyone working with databases.

    Database Design for Mere Mortals Review

    Database Design for Mere Mortals (2003) uncovers the complexities of database design in a clear and accessible manner. Here's why this book is a gem:
    • It breaks down complex concepts into simple, easy-to-understand explanations, making it ideal for beginners and experts alike.
    • With real-world examples and practical scenarios, it helps readers grasp the importance of sound database design principles in any project.
    • The book's attention to detail ensures a comprehensive understanding of database design concepts, keeping readers engaged from cover to cover.

    Who should read Database Design for Mere Mortals?

    • Individuals who want to learn the fundamentals of database design

    • Professionals who need to create or maintain databases for their job

    • Students or educators in the field of computer science or information technology

    About the Author

    Michael J. Hernandez is a renowned author and expert in the field of database design. With over 20 years of experience, he has written several highly acclaimed books on the subject. Hernandez's work, including 'Database Design for Mere Mortals,' is known for its clear and practical approach, making complex concepts accessible to readers of all levels. His books have become essential resources for both beginners and experienced professionals looking to master the art of database design.

    Categories with Database Design for Mere Mortals

    People ❤️ Blinkist 
    Sven O.

    It's highly addictive to get core insights on personally relevant topics without repetition or triviality. Added to that the apps ability to suggest kindred interests opens up a foundation of knowledge.

    Thi Viet Quynh N.

    Great app. Good selection of book summaries you can read or listen to while commuting. Instead of scrolling through your social media news feed, this is a much better way to spend your spare time in my opinion.

    Jonathan A.

    Life changing. The concept of being able to grasp a book's main point in such a short time truly opens multiple opportunities to grow every area of your life at a faster rate.

    Renee D.

    Great app. Addicting. Perfect for wait times, morning coffee, evening before bed. Extremely well written, thorough, easy to use.

    4.8 Stars
    Average ratings on iOS and Google Play
    43 Million
    Downloads on all platforms
    10+ years
    Experience igniting personal growth
    Get started for free
    Powerful ideas from top nonfiction

    Try Blinkist to get the key ideas from 7,500+ bestselling nonfiction titles and podcasts. Listen or read in just 15 minutes.

    Get started for free

    Database Design for Mere Mortals FAQs 

    What is the main message of Database Design for Mere Mortals?

    The main message of Database Design for Mere Mortals is making database concepts easy and accessible.

    How long does it take to read Database Design for Mere Mortals?

    The estimated reading time for Database Design for Mere Mortals varies but reading the Blinkist summary would take just a few minutes.

    Is Database Design for Mere Mortals a good book? Is it worth reading?

    Database Design for Mere Mortals is worth reading as it simplifies complex topics, making database design enjoyable and understandable.

    Who is the author of Database Design for Mere Mortals?

    Michael J. Hernandez is the author of Database Design for Mere Mortals.

    What to read after Database Design for Mere Mortals?

    If you're wondering what to read next after Database Design for Mere Mortals, here are some recommendations we suggest:
    • Big Data by Viktor Mayer-Schönberger and Kenneth Cukier
    • Physics of the Future by Michio Kaku
    • On Intelligence by Jeff Hawkins and Sandra Blakeslee
    • Brave New War by John Robb
    • Abundance# by Peter H. Diamandis and Steven Kotler
    • The Signal and the Noise by Nate Silver
    • You Are Not a Gadget by Jaron Lanier
    • The Future of the Mind by Michio Kaku
    • The Second Machine Age by Erik Brynjolfsson and Andrew McAfee
    • Out of Control by Kevin Kelly